Tour Overview

Porto Walking Food Tour With Secret Food Tours - Tour Overview

The Secret Food Tours’ Porto Walking Food Tour combines sightseeing of the city’s top landmarks with tastings of local Portuguese delicacies.

This 3-3.5 hour tour takes participants through the downtown Porto and Ribeira neighborhoods, allowing them to explore the charming streets and architecture while indulging in specialties like sponge cakes, canned fish, bifana (pork sandwiches), francesinha (a beef and cheese appetizer with spicy sauce), and a secret dish.

Hotel pick-up and drop-off are included, and the tour has a maximum group size of 12 travelers.

With 144 reviews and a Badge of Excellence, this walking food tour offers an immersive way to experience the culinary and cultural highlights of Porto.

Meeting and End Points

At the meeting point of Coliseu Porto Ageas on Rua Passos Manuel, 137, the walking food tour commences, with the experience culminating near the Cais da Ribeira 36, close to the iconic Ponte D. Luiz Bridge. This convenient centralized location allows for seamless transportation to and from the tour. The start and end points are strategically chosen to provide easy access to Porto’s vibrant downtown and the picturesque Ribeira neighborhood, ensuring participants can fully enjoy the city’s culinary and cultural highlights.
